What Pendle does
Pendle is a yield-trading protocol that tokenises future yield. Deposit a yield-bearing asset — a staked ETH derivative, a stablecoin vault token, a restaking receipt — and Pendle splits it into two tradable pieces: a Principal Token (PT), redeemable 1:1 for the underlying at maturity, and a Yield Token (YT), which entitles the holder to all the yield generated over that period. Sell your PT at a discount and you've effectively locked in a fixed rate; buy YT and you're taking a leveraged bet on yield going up.
That splitting mechanism sounds niche until you realise what it enables. Conservative holders can lock in fixed yield on volatile-rate assets instead of gambling on floating APYs. Yield speculators can get outsized exposure to rate movements without touching the underlying principal. And Pendle's custom AMM, designed specifically for assets that decay toward a known redemption value, keeps slippage low even as maturity approaches — a problem generic AMMs handle poorly.
Why it took off
Pendle's real breakout came with the 2023-24 restaking and points-farming boom. LRTs (liquid restaking tokens) and other points-bearing assets are notoriously hard to price, and Pendle became the default venue for traders to speculate on or hedge future airdrop and yield outcomes tied to those points. Billions in TVL flowed in during EigenLayer and Ethena's rise, and Pendle expanded aggressively to Arbitrum, BNB Chain and beyond. vePENDLE, the vote-escrowed governance token, lets long-term lockers direct emissions to specific pools and capture a cut of protocol swap fees — a Curve-style flywheel that's kept liquidity sticky.
Risks worth knowing
Pendle's value is directly coupled to the DeFi yield and points-farming cycle that made it popular — when restaking and points speculation cool off, TVL and fee revenue cool off with it. The protocol is also only as safe as the yield-bearing assets it wraps: if an underlying LRT, LST or stablecoin depegs or gets exploited, Pendle's PT and YT markets for that asset take the hit too, even though the bug lives elsewhere. Smart contract risk compounds across two layers — Pendle's own contracts plus whatever protocol issued the wrapped yield source — and the AMM's fixed-maturity design means liquidity can thin out sharply as pools approach expiry.
